Vietnam Garden Products: Key Sectors and Strengths
ET2C’s Vietnam Sourcing Team has already identified strong opportunities within the Vietnam Garden Products and Outdoor sector. This is due to raw material availability as well as manufacturing capability already in place. Combined with favorable political, social, and economic factors, Vietnam Garden Products present a significant opportunity on the global stage.
Although relations between the United States and China appear to be improving, Vietnam continues to attract U.S. buyers because of tariffs on Chinese products. These tariffs could raise costs by up to 25% this year if no agreement is reached. As a result, many companies are de-risking supply chains and spreading their sourcing across multiple jurisdictions. The Vietnam Garden Products sector will play an important role in this Asian sourcing strategy, with suppliers investing in manufacturing capacity and R&D.
As your Asian sourcing expert, we have highlighted some of the key Vietnam Garden Products categories. These include pottery, netting, garden tools, gloves, plant supports, arches, obelisks, hanging baskets, coco-liners, and outdoor furniture. Vietnam Garden Products : Pottery Supplier
After a two-hour drive, we arrived at a vast manufacturing site in Binh Duong Province. The site was bustling, with three containers being loaded as we pulled in.
The company CEO, Mrs. T, was waiting for us outside her office with some of her key staff.
We were shown around two large showrooms, filled with different product ranges and finishes, followed by their cavernous warehouse. It was immediately clear that this factory was well set up for export, with certifications including TQM, BSCI, and C-TPAT.
Established in 1999, the company manufactures ceramics, cement-based, and polyresin housewares. Their product portfolio includes ceramics, terrazzo, terracotta, pottery, high-fired, lite stone, and poly stone, among other key styles.
Vietnam Garden Products: Interview
1. Which countries within the Asian Region do you see as your main competitors?
Within Asia, I see Malaysia and Thailand as our main competition. They do not have the labour cost advantage that Vietnam has and therefore mainly produce larger sizes by machine. They also do not have the range of colour options. China is always a competitor, due to its depth of manufacturing, but they are certainly volume geared.
2. What does ‘Sustainability’ mean to your business?
Sustainability means putting an emphasis on our staff and ensuring that they are treated in an ethical and fair way. Also, looking at focusing on the environment and our processes.
3. How do you continue to develop your export market and client base?
We have put a great focus on innovation and look to develop new and unique designs for our clients. Also, the service and quality we provide to our clients is key to grow our business with them as well as identify new clients at Global trade shows. We are also looking to engage more with social media.
4. What are your biggest challenges as a business?
From both an internal and external perspective, with increasing demand, we need to properly manage our staff base and production capability. One of the biggest challenges is the Government restrictions on pottery Kilns as we need to make sure we have space to fire our ceramics.
5. What is the future for the Vietnam manufacturing base in your product category?
The pottery industry in Vietnam is well established and has been exporting products for a long time now. There is innovation coming into the Homewares category and this is evident with the introduction of lightweight options. These are cement compositions (such as polyresin) and have shorter lead times, are lightweight and can be used to make lots of contemporary styles. We have our own unique features, that we have honed over our years of experience, such as unique glazes, water & frost resistance, and special surfaces.
Vietnam Garden Products: Summary
Vietnam Garden Products Essential Insights & Opportunities The Vietnamese Pottery industry is underpinned by over a thousand years of artisan expertise and has developed to the mass market offering that it is today. Although labour is still an important part, there is increasing investment in machinery to make the process more efficient. Moreover, this will detemine more advantageous costs on a global stage. New alternative materials have also become more prevalent as different options for the consumer.
